It looks like our final stack has been ‘approved’ by the powers to me (or influential people who make things happens). It is quite simple:
- Redis 3 with clustering (hopefully it works as this is written in C) with ZeroMQ Pub/Sub message queuing between Java clients to listeners of IQFeed or broker connections including Interactive Brokers or Oanda.
- Utilize Matlab/Simulink Coder Generation capabilities to C to integrate with Redis on a local build tom implement model/strategy/algo.
- All done in minimal Linux with non Windows due to recent hack (call me paranoid!)
- Use a simple Java JChart2d project to be integrated into Java client for Redis datastore.
